Smart Kitchens: The Backbone of the Restaurant of the Future

In the rapidly evolving world of quick service restaurants (QSRs), the spotlight often shines on customer-facing innovations—mobile ordering, digital loyalty, and seamless omnichannel experiences. Yet, the true engine powering the restaurant of the future lies behind the scenes: the smart kitchen. As labor shortages persist and operational costs rise, smart kitchen technologies—automation, IoT devices, predictive analytics, and geolocation—are transforming back-of-house operations, delivering speed, accuracy, and quality at scale.

The Smart Kitchen Revolution: More Than Just Automation

Smart kitchens are not a single technology, but an integrated ecosystem designed to optimize every step of the order fulfillment process. By leveraging automation, real-time data, and advanced analytics, these kitchens streamline food preparation across all channels—dine-in, drive-thru, mobile, and delivery. The result? Faster service, fewer errors, and consistently high food quality, regardless of how or where the customer orders.

Incremental Steps: Building the Smart Kitchen of Tomorrow, Today

While some smart kitchen innovations may seem futuristic, many QSRs already have foundational elements in place. The path to a fully smart kitchen is incremental and accessible:

  1. Leverage Existing Data: Start by integrating POS and digital order data to track wait times, order accuracy, and kitchen bottlenecks. Use these insights to identify quick wins.
  2. Pilot Automation: Test robotic assistants or AI-powered order taking in high-volume locations. Focus on tasks that are repetitive and prone to error.
  3. Enable Geolocation: Activate location-based features in your mobile app to automate check-in and trigger order prep as customers approach.
  4. Connect IoT Devices: Upgrade kitchen equipment with sensors to monitor performance, reduce downtime, and optimize maintenance schedules.
  5. Invest in Change Management: Ensure staff are trained and supported as new technologies are introduced. Position automation as a tool to empower employees, not replace them.
